Career Path

The Global Certificate in Nutritional Markers: Global Perspectives program prepares students for a variety of rewarding careers in the nutrition field, including dietitians, nutritionists, nutritional therapists, and public health nutritionists. Each role plays a crucial part in promoting health and well-being in diverse settings, from hospitals and clinics to community centers and private practices. Dietitians, for instance, focus on creating meal plans and providing nutrition education to patients with specific medical needs. They often work in hospitals, long-term care facilities, or outpatient clinics, and their expertise is invaluable in managing conditions such as diabetes, obesity, and food allergies. Nutritionists, on the other hand, typically work with healthier individuals, helping them make informed food choices to maintain their well-being and prevent illness. They may be employed by wellness centers, gyms, or corporate environments, and their duties may include designing customized meal plans, conducting body composition assessments, and providing educational workshops. Nutritional therapists specialize in using whole, organic foods and natural supplements to address underlying health issues and imbalances. They often work in private practice, treating clients with chronic conditions such as autoimmune disorders, digestive issues, and mood disorders. Public health nutritionists focus on promoting health and preventing disease in populations rather than individuals. They may work for government agencies, non-profit organizations, or research institutions, developing policies and programs to improve food access, food security, and overall community health. These career paths are not only personally fulfilling but also in high demand, as the public becomes increasingly aware of the importance of nutrition in preventing and managing chronic diseases.
